Worked example
- 1.Adım 1 (F1): Step 1: Rank each alternative on each criterion (1 = best). For benefit: rank 1 = highest value. For cost: rank 1 = lowest value. Ties get average rank. Formül: \rho_{ij} = \text{rank of alternative } i \text{ on criterion } j \text{ (1=best, ties=average)} Anchor: Raveh 2000, p.672
- 2.Adım 2 (F2): Step 2: Compute FUCA score F_i = weighted sum of per-criterion ranks. Rank ascending (lower = better). Formül: F_{i} = \sum_{j=1}^{n}w_{j}\,\rho_{ij} Anchor: Raveh 2000, p.672
